Responsibilities
- Manage the entire bid process from initial inquiry through final proposal submission for assigned electrical projects.
- Attend pre-bid meetings and conduct site visits (virtual or in-person as required) to thoroughly understand project scope, conditions, and requirements.
- Perform comprehensive quantity take-offs from blueprints, electrical drawings, specifications, and other bid documents.
- Develop detailed material, labor, equipment, and subcontractor cost estimates.
- Identify and evaluate project risks and opportunities to ensure accurate and competitive pricing.
- Present estimates and proposals to internal teams and external clients.
- Maintain and update internal cost databases and historical project data.
- Collaborate closely with Project Managers, Engineers, and other stakeholders during the estimating phase.
